Dj Phat Bone earns ‘Best DJ Upper East’ Nomination for 2018 Ghana DJ Awards.

- Advertisement -

One of Upper East region finest Disc Jockeys and event organizer, Seidu Sulemana Akurugu, popularly known as DJ Phat Bone has earned a nomination in the “Best DJ Upper East” category at the 2018 edition of the Ghana DJ Awards.

DJ Phat Bone who co-hosts the Sunset Drive on A1 Radio in Bolgatanga was nominated in this year’s edition at the launch of the awards on Friday, April 6th in Accra.

Phat Bone is widely known for his unique voice and taste for music selection both on radio and at events. He has many times been touted as the best and most hard working DJ in the region who gets listeners “locked down on their radio sets” and patrons of events on their feet. His contenders in the “Best DJ Upper East” category this year include DJ Prince, DJ Dubai, Dj Okokobioko, and DJ Aluther who won in this category last year.

The nomination of the “Master Turntablist” comes as no surprise as he has worked hard to carve a niche for himself in the field. The Ghana DJ Awards was created to celebrate and appreciate the talents of Disc Jockeys (DJs) across the globe who promote Ghanaian music. The awards is an annual program designed to foster the development of the Ghana Music Industry by rewarding and celebrating radio, mobile and club Disc Jockeys who have excelled in their fields of endeavour.

It is the only national Award Scheme in Africa that exclusively appreciates and celebrates Disc Jockeys for their work. It is also a platform that rewards veteran DJs who have blazed the trail in the music industry over the years.
